Obama: Access Denied


Now that Obama is no longer President, he'll have even MORE time to golf (as if he didn't play enough while in office).  He's already played 306 times in the past 8 years according to obamagolfcounter.com.  Ok, so he's got nothing on me, but that is a LOT for a President.   He's recently purchased a home in D.C. and members at the exclusive Woodmont Country Club have corroborated to deny him membership.  See, Woodmont is an exclusive Jewish owned club and their resentment is due to Obama's recent decision not to have the U.S. veto a U.N. Security Council resolution that was critical of Israeli settlements in East Jerusalem and the West Bank, and from Secretary of State John Kerry's speech days later accusing Israeli Prime Minister Netanyahu of undermining the possibility of a two-state solution.

"(President Obama) has created a situation in the world where Israel's very existence is weakened and possibly threatened," longtime member Faith Goldstein wrote in a December 26th email obtained by the Washington Post.  "He is not welcome at Woodmont.  His admittance would create a storm that could destroy our club."
